The Supreme Court ordered Pennsylvania Democrats to respond by Thursday evening in a case challenging the stateās three-day extension for counting mail-in ballots.Ā President Trump has moved to intervene in a lawsuit brought by Pennsylvania Republicans, arguing the stateās Democratic Party and Secretary of State violated the law by extending the time for counting mail-in ballots to Nov. 6 at 5 p.m., despite the state legislature setting the deadline as Election Day. On the plain language, they may have a shot at ending this counting of ballots past election day.
